These healthy, high-protein recipes are sure to leave everyone feeling plenty satisfied, reducing the chance of a hungry, rumbly belly at bedtime. Research suggests that you should aim toget 10% to 35% of your calories from protein. With each of these recipescontaining at least 15 grams of protein per serving, they’ll help you and your family meet your nutritional goals.

High-protein dinner ideas like our Cheesy Ground Beef & Cauliflower Casserole and One-Pot Lentil & Vegetable Soup with Parmesan are tasty, satisfying meals that everyone at the table can enjoy.

One-Pot Lentil & Vegetable Soup with Parmesan

Antonis Achilleos

One-Pot Lentil & Vegetable Soup with Parmesan

This lentil-vegetable soup is packed with kale and tomatoes for a filling, flavorful main dish. If you have it, the Parmesan cheese rind adds nuttiness and gives the broth some body. If you avoid cheese made with animal rennet, look for Parmesan cheese made with vegetarian enzymes.

One-Pot Beef Stroganoff

Photography / Greg DuPree, Styling / Ruth BlackBurn / Julia Bayless

one-pot-beef-stroganoff

This one-pot beef stroganoff recipe cuts down on dishes but not on flavor! Mixed mushrooms and sirloin steak layer on the umami flavors, while sour cream with a hint of Dijon mustard carries the sauce. Coating the steak in baking soda before cooking helps to tenderize it, but you can skip this step to speed things up if needed.

One-Pot Spaghetti with Meat Sauce

One-Pot Spaghetti with Meat Sauce

The whole family is sure to love this one-pot spaghetti recipe! The sausage, chicken broth and white wine impart slow-cooked flavors in this quick-cooking ragu. As the pasta sauce thickens, you’ll want to scrape the bottom of the pot to prevent the sauce and pasta from sticking and to help the pasta cook evenly.

One-Pot Chicken Pasta with Cajun Seasonings

One-Pot Chicken Pasta with Cajun Seasonings

This one-pot chicken pasta dish with Cajun seasonings is a snap to whip up. Here, we use the technique of stirring often to help the starches release for natural creaminess. We love the spicy flavor profile of Cajun seasoning, but you can substitute different spices depending on what you have on hand.

Roast Za’atar Chicken Thighs with Broccoli & Potatoes

Roast Za’atar Chicken Thighs with Broccoli & Potatoes

The broiler is the key to getting this za’atar chicken golden in color without overcooking the meat—after the chicken roasts, the broiler blasts the top, crisping the skin.

Shakshuka (Eggs Poached in Spicy Tomato Sauce)

Shakshuka (Eggs Poached in Spicy Tomato Sauce)

Shakshuka is a veggie-packed meal featuring eggs cooked in a mixture of tomatoes, onions, peppers and spices. It’s often served for breakfast or lunch in North Africa and the Middle East.
